none
请问:在Win2003下,能否为NETWORK SERVICE账户配置打印服务的操作权限?如果可以请提示如何操作,谢谢 RRS feed

  • 问题

  • 在Win2003下,能否为NETWORK SERVICE账户配置打印服务的操作权限?如果可以请提示如何操作。

    我想在IIS6.0下部署ASP.net网站,远程用户通过ASP.net网站调用Win2003上的打印服务功能,我试了很多方法都失败,估计是打印服务权限的问题(以打印Word文档为例:通过观察Win2003上的任务管理器发现以NETWORK SERVICE账户身份启动的WORD实例已经运行)。

    服务器端执行如下代码

                    Process myProcess = new Process();
                    myProcess.StartInfo.FileName = @"C:\temp\目标文档.doc";
                    myProcess.StartInfo.Verb = "Print";
                    myProcess.StartInfo.CreateNoWindow = true;
                    myProcess.Start();

    请大家指点一下,换一种实现方式也行,只要能在IIS下能够执行打印服务就行,多谢了!

    2010年4月23日 12:40

答案